猿代码 — 科研/AI模型/高性能计算
0

"高性能计算中的数据并行优化策略与实践"

摘要: 在高性能计算领域,数据并行优化策略是至关重要的一环。数据并行是指多个处理单元同时处理不同的数据集,通过将任务分割成更小的数据集进行处理,以提高计算效率和性能。随着计算机科学和技术的飞速发展,数据并行计 ...
在高性能计算领域,数据并行优化策略是至关重要的一环。数据并行是指多个处理单元同时处理不同的数据集,通过将任务分割成更小的数据集进行处理,以提高计算效率和性能。随着计算机科学和技术的飞速发展,数据并行计算在各个领域都扮演着不可或缺的角色。

随着大数据时代的到来,数据量不断增加,如何有效地管理和处理这些海量数据成为了一个亟待解决的问题。而在高性能计算中,数据并行优化策略更是需要高度重视。通过合理的数据并行划分和处理,可以有效减少计算时间和提高计算效率,从而更好地应对复杂的计算任务。

在实际应用中,数据并行优化策略的选择取决于具体的计算任务和数据特征。一般来说,可以采用数据划分、任务划分、负载均衡等方法来优化数据并行计算。数据划分是将数据集划分成多个子集,分配给不同的处理单元并行处理,可以提高并行度和减少通信开销。任务划分则是将计算任务划分成多个子任务,分配给不同处理单元执行,以实现任务间的并行执行。

负载均衡是指在多处理器系统中,合理地分配任务和数据,使得各处理单元的工作负载尽可能均衡,避免出现瓶颈和性能不均衡的情况。负载均衡是数据并行优化中至关重要的一环,能够有效提高系统整体的性能和效率。

除了数据并行优化策略之外,还需要结合硬件优化、算法优化等手段来进一步提升高性能计算系统的性能。硬件优化包括选择适合应用需求的高性能计算设备和网络设备,提高系统的吞吐量和计算能力;算法优化则是通过设计高效的算法和数据结构,减少计算和通信开销,提高系统的计算速度和效率。

在高性能计算中,数据并行优化策略是提升系统性能和效率的关键。通过合理选择和应用数据并行优化策略,可以有效提高计算速度和效率,满足复杂计算任务的需求。在未来的研究中,我们需要不断探索更加有效的数据并行优化策略,推动高性能计算技术的发展和应用,为各领域的科学计算和工程应用提供更好的支持。

说点什么...

已有0条评论

最新评论...

本文作者
2024-12-20 19:37
  • 0
    粉丝
  • 249
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)